The product managers and developers for GlobalMovers.com have spent considerable effort to improve the performance of the website. Now they are trying to determine the best way to measure the performance of the site. What is one factor they should consider in choosing performance metrics?

Correct answer: Using real-world results instead of lab-testing results.
Why this is the answer
While lab testing provides controlled environments, real-world results offer a more accurate picture of how users experience the website under varying conditions (network speeds, device types, browser versions, etc.). This is crucial for conversion optimization because it reflects actual user behavior and potential roadblocks to conversion. The ratio of total visitors to total hits is not a standard performance metric and doesn't directly indicate site speed or user experience. Separating spider hits from cached and visitor hits is important for accurate traffic analysis but doesn't directly measure website performance from a user's perspective. Cloud-based testing services can simulate user experience but are still a form of lab testing; real-world data from actual users is superior for understanding true performance.
